India, Nov. 1 -- Many Americans relying on Social Security Administration (SSA) benefits may be wondering why their next payment isn't arriving on November 1.
The reason is that November 1 falls on a Saturday, triggering the SSA's policy of issuing payments on the last business day before a weekend or holiday.
For recipients of Supplemental Security Income (SSI) (a monthly benefit for older adults or disabled persons with limited income), the November payment arrived on Friday, October 31.
The important fact to know is that this October 31 payment counts as the November benefit. That means there will be no additional SSI payment in November. The next regular payout will come on Monday, December 1.
